As a Senior Analyst – Business Operations, Flights, you will play a key role in driving operational excellence through analysis, automation, and process improvement. You will serve as the bridge between frontline operations and system owners, ensuring workflows are efficient, data-driven, and scalable.
This role requires strong analytical and problem-solving skills, as well as the ability to partner effectively across functions to identify inefficiencies, recommend solutions, and support the rollout of automation initiatives.
What You’ll Do
Process Optimization & Automation Support
- Identify and assess automation opportunities in flight operations workflows.
- Work with Product and Engineering teams to define and test requirements for automation tools.
- Monitor automation effectiveness and provide data-driven recommendations.
Operational Troubleshooting & Analysis
- Lead investigations into recurring operational issues or exceptions.
- Analyze data to identify patterns, root causes, and potential solutions.
- Support operational pilots and efficiency projects aimed at reducing manual work.
- Troubleshoot escalated issues within operations, identifying root causes and implementing solutions.
Stakeholder Collaboration
- Act as a subject matter expert for operational workflows within the flights domain.
- Partner closely with Service Delivery and Vendor teams to gather insights and feedback.
- Communicate clearly across technical and non-technical teams.
Documentation & Training
- Own the creation and maintenance of SOPs, process maps, and training guides.
Support onboarding and cross-training efforts across teams.
What You’ll Bring
- 3–5 years of experience in travel operations, ideally within a TMC, OTA, or airline environment.
Hands-on experience with GDS systems (Sabre, Amadeus preferred). - Strong analytical mindset, with experience in process improvement or automation projects.
- Ability to translate operational needs into technical requirements.
-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and problem-solving skills.
